Insurance requirements in Greenville
 
If you own a vehicle that is currently registered in the state of South Carolina, you must have car insurance in Greenville. Drivers must have at least 25/50/25 personal liability insurance, which includes the following: 

Per person, $25,000 in bodily injury liability coverage is provided.
 
Per accident, $50,000 in bodily injury liability coverage is provided.
 
Property damage liability coverage of $25,000 per accident
 
South Carolina also requires drivers to have uninsured motorist coverage in the amount of $25,000 per person and $50,000 per accident.

Drivers who purchase a policy with the bare minimum of coverage frequently pay the lowest rate. Minimum coverage insurance, on the other hand, may not cover the full cost of an accident, leaving drivers with out-of-pocket expenses in the event of an at-fault loss. Similarly, liability-only coverage provides no coverage for your own vehicle. To protect their asset, most lenders will require you to carry full coverage insurance, including collision and comprehensive insurance, if you lease or finance your car.

Greenville auto insurance discounts
 
Most car insurance companies in Greenville offer discounts that can help drivers reduce their insurance costs. Some of the most common discounts in Greenville are: 

Multi-policy discount: Drivers who purchase two policies from the same carrier, such as home and auto insurance, may be eligible for a lower premium.
 
Claims-free discount: If you haven't had any accidents in the last few years, your insurance company may offer you a claims-free discount.
 
Telematics discount: You can often get a lower car insurance premium if you drive safely and agree to let your insurance company track your driving habits.
 
Smart student discount: Students who maintain a minimum GPA in high school or college are often eligible for a discount on their insurance policy.
